Window Replacement

Window replacement is a fantastic option to improve the efficiency of your home, reduce noise, and increase security. It is important to partner with a reputable service provider or manufacturer to ensure that the new windows are of the highest quality, properly measured, and correctly installed. This will increase the value of your investment and help you get the most efficient results. Replacement windows are an excellent option for older homes with single-pane windows that don't effectively block UV radiations or insulate.

The replacement of your window glass is among the most cost-effective methods to improve your home's insulation and efficiency. New uPVC and wooden frames offer excellent insulation against cold, wind, and rain, while double-glazed units with low-emissivity (low-e) coatings and argon gas fillings significantly reduce heat transfer to lower energy bills. The best double-pane windows are also sound protected and have multi-point locking systems for enhanced security.

Replacement of a single pane within double-glazed windows can cost between PS55 and PS145 based on the size and style. However, it's typically cheaper to repair a blown window, and it's vital to have a professional evaluation of the situation and recommendations before deciding to replace or repair your windows.

If your double-glazed windows are cloudy it could be a sign of a leak or issue with the seal. It can be resolved by using a specialized repair process that removes the moisture and then cleans the glass unit, and then installs a new spacer bar and desiccant in order to stop future condensation. The repair procedure can be carried out at home or at the site, and it's typically much cheaper than replacing the entire window.

Replacing a damaged double pane is the most cost-effective option however, it's not always possible to replace only the glass. Double-paned windows are equipped with a space in between the two glass panes which is sealed with Krypton gas or argon. This creates an airtight seal and reduces the loss of energy. If a single pane is broken, it's typically required to replace the entire window in order to maintain energy efficiency and ensure a tight airtight seal.

Misted Double Glazing

Double glazing that is contaminated could pose a risk to homeowners. It can affect how well your windows function, and can result in dampness, mold and high energy bills. As winter draws near, it's essential that you fix any issues with double glazing repaired as quickly as you can.

If the glass in your windows develops condensation between the panes, this is called misting. It is typically caused by poor installation and air infiltration. The best way to avoid this is to make use of a FENSA approved window installer.

Keep your double glazing free of dirt, dust and other debris. Applying warm soapy water to the frames is the easiest way to clean most uPVC double glazing. However it is important to note that if the frames are made of aluminum or wood it is possible to try some other methods for cleaning them thoroughly.

One of the most common problems that double glazing owners face after installation is that their doors or windows become difficult to open or close. This may be caused by extreme temperatures as the frame expands or shrinks based on the weather. It is worth trying to warm up or cool down the frame with hot or cold water as well as adjust any hinges, handles or mechanisms. If this doesn't work then you should contact the company that installed your double glazing. They might be able to offer a repair service or refund.

If you notice that your double-glazed windows are leaking, this could be due to the seal between the two panes has failed. This could be caused by a variety of factors, including poor installation, aging or the use of harsh chemicals or cleaners based on oil. It is also recommended to use an approved installer FENSA-regulated to make sure that your double-glazing complies completely with UK building regulations.

In some cases you can fix the double-glazing unit that is misted by replacing the bars that hold the spacers with ones that are warmer. This can help to stop condensation by increasing the temperature of the glass. Alternately, you can opt for thermally efficient glass with low emission coatings and argon gas between the glass to reduce condensation.

Skylight Repair

Skylights are a great option to let natural light without overwhelming the space. Skylights are also a great way to add extra insulation and cut down on heating expenses. Like all windows or doors, they can experience a variety problems. It is essential to seek out a professional as soon as a double-pane skylight is damaged. This will stop condensation, water leaks, and other damages to the frame and glass.

Skylight leaks typically occur when the glazing seal and flashing loosen or when the frame begins corroding. These problems could cause water to leak from the frame into the ceiling. A professional can fix a skylight that is leaking by sealing or replacing the flashing, seal, and frame. The cost of fixing skylights will differ depending on the window size and the type of glass. If the frame is severely damaged, it could be worth replacing it.

Another issue with skylights is the presence of mold. Mold can appear on the outside, inside or the frame of the skylight. It could be caused by condensation, leaky pipes or a faulty seal. If the mold is limited to the surrounding area of the window, minor repairs can be completed. If the mold is widespread, the skylight might need to be replaced.
